OPA4330AID Overview


The linear amplifier is packaged in a 14-SOIC (0.154, 3.90mm Width) case. This is a Zero-Drift type op amp. Linear amplifier is delivered in a Tube case. The number of terminations approaches 14. Buffer amplifier has a total of 14 pins. Please take in mind that this instrumentation amplifier should be run at 5V. The buffer op amp includes 14 pins. Regarding input offset voltage, op amp rates 50μV. Surface Mount is the recommended mounting type for this linear amplifier. With regard to operating temperature, this op amp functions well at -40°C~125°C. This op amp can operate from a supply current at 21μA. It is a member of the 115dB's 115dB family. The op amp ic has 4 channels on it. This op amp ic outputs Rail-to-Rail signals, which is one of the many benefits it has.
